campfire an outdoor fire used for cooking or warmth while camping.
daily happening or done every day.
danger a chance or likelihood that something bad or harmful may happen; peril; risk.
flame the hot, bright gas that you see when something burns.
forward toward a place or time that is further on or in the future; ahead.
graph a drawing that shows information and the relationships between pieces of that information.
hair a single, thin structure like a thread that grows on the body of humans and some animals.
lab a short form of laboratory.
main most important.
meal1 an occasion when people prepare and eat food at a specific time.
seem to appear to be or do.
slime a slippery liquid, such as thin mud or the slippery substance on fish.
station the place where a person or thing is normally found.
steal to take something from another person without permission and in a way that is against the law.
threaten to say that you will harm or punish some person or group if something that you demand is not done.
